summ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Simon Rettberg2019-10-30 16:20:04 +0100
committerSimon Rettberg2019-10-30 16:20:04 +0100
commit71ed81a63182eca3f88356eaa99bacd87b68cdce (patch)
tree8763fb73cd579b88b9636e5425466818fa09f729
parent[minilinux] Add some tool-tips (diff)
downloadslx-admin-71ed81a63182eca3f88356eaa99bacd87b68cdce.tar.gz
slx-admin-71ed81a63182eca3f88356eaa99bacd87b68cdce.tar.xz
slx-admin-71ed81a63182eca3f88356eaa99bacd87b68cdce.zip
[sysconfig] Disable gzip output handler when delivering config.tgz
-rw-r--r--modules-available/sysconfig/api.inc.php1
1 files changed, 1 insertions, 0 deletions
diff --git a/modules-available/sysconfig/api.inc.php b/modules-available/sysconfig/api.inc.php
index bb2d9f5e..1319fc5f 100644
--- a/modules-available/sysconfig/api.inc.php
+++ b/modules-available/sysconfig/api.inc.php
@@ -79,6 +79,7 @@ if ($runmode !== false && $runmode->noSysconfig && file_exists(SysConfig::GLOBAL
}
}
+@ob_end_clean(); // Disable gzip output handler since this is already a compressed file
Header('Content-Type: application/gzip');
Header('Content-Disposition: attachment; filename=' . Util::sanitizeFilename($row['title']) . '.tgz');
$ret = readfile($row['filepath']);